A tunnel oven
By introducing a mixing chamber and a makeup air assembly into the tunnel oven, air circulation in the preheating and high-temperature sections is realized, solving the problem of unutilized exhaust air in existing technologies, reducing operating costs and minimizing environmental impact.

AI Technical Summary
In existing tunnel ovens, the exhaust air from the preheating and cooling sections cannot be reused during operation, resulting in high operating costs and significant environmental impact.
A mixing chamber is introduced into the tunnel oven, and the exhaust air from the high-temperature section and the cooling section is introduced into the mixing chamber through the make-up air assembly. After mixing with the exhaust air from the preheating section, the air is recycled to the preheating section and the high-temperature section. The make-up air fan and filter ensure that the air quality and temperature are balanced.
It enables air recycling in the preheating and high-temperature sections, reducing equipment operating costs, minimizing external exhaust, and improving environmental friendliness.

Technical Field
[0001] This invention relates to the field of food and pharmaceutical packaging machinery, and in particular to a tunnel-type drying oven. Background Technology
[0002] In recent years, people have paid increasing attention to the operating costs of equipment and its environmental impact. Existing tunnel ovens, which use outdoor exhaust ventilation, are not the optimal choice in terms of either operating costs or environmental protection. Specifically, for example... Figure 1 As shown, during operation, the air intake and exhaust volumes in the bottle washing room are basically consistent. The preheating and high-temperature sections require supplemental air from the bottle washing room. After heat exchange with the bottles, a small portion of the air in the preheating section is discharged to the bottle washing room, while the majority is discharged outdoors. In the high-temperature section, the air is heated by a heater, increasing both temperature and pressure. After heat exchange with the bottles, part of the hot air is discharged to the preheating section, and the other part is discharged to the cooling section. For the cooling section, in addition to the air flowing in from the high-temperature section, there is also air flowing in from the filling room. Both of these air components exchange heat with the bottles before being discharged outdoors. The air discharged from the preheating and cooling sections is not reused, increasing the operating costs of the equipment and also having a significant environmental impact. Summary of the Invention

[0027] The application will be further described in detail below in combination with the accompanying drawings and specific embodiments.
[0028] Figures 2 to 7 An embodiment of the tunnel oven of the application is shown. The tunnel oven of the embodiment comprises a preheating section 1, a high-temperature section 2 and a cooling section 3 which are sequentially butted. The preheating section 1 is provided with a mixing chamber 43 (of course, in other embodiments, the mixing chamber 43 can be arranged at other positions, but compared with the embodiment, the overall pipeline structure of the oven will become complex, the length will increase, and the corresponding equipment cost will also increase). A first air supplement assembly 4 is arranged between the exhaust outlet of the preheating section 1 and the mixing chamber 43. The mixing chamber 43 is communicated with the air inlet of the preheating section 1 through a first air outlet 431. A second air supplement assembly 5 is arranged between the second air outlet 432 of the mixing chamber 43 and the air inlet of the high-temperature section 2. A third air supplement assembly 6 is arranged between the exhaust outlet of the cooling section 3 and the mixing chamber 43.
[0029] In operation, the hot air of the high-temperature section 2 enters the preheating section 1 and the cooling section 3 due to the high temperature and high pressure. A part of the hot air enters the mixing chamber 43 through the first air supplement assembly 4 along with the exhaust air of the preheating section 1. Another part of the hot air enters the cooling section 3. The exhaust air of the cooling section 3 enters the mixing chamber 43 through the third air supplement assembly 6. The exhaust air of the preheating section 1 and the exhaust air of the cooling section 3 are mixed and heat exchanged in the mixing chamber 43, so that the temperature and humidity are balanced. A part of the air in the mixing chamber 43 enters the preheating section 1 through the first air outlet 431 to supplement the air of the preheating section 1. Another part of the air in the mixing chamber 43 enters the high-temperature section 2 through the second air outlet 432 and the second air supplement assembly 5 to supplement the air of the high-temperature section 2. Thus, the air circulation of the preheating section 1, the high-temperature section 2 and the cooling section 3 is realized. The influence of the temperature and humidity on the preheating section 1 and the high-temperature section 2 is reduced. The structure is simple, which is conducive to reducing the operation cost of the oven, reducing the exhaust air, and saving energy and protecting the environment.
[0030] Further, in the embodiment, the first air supplement assembly 4 comprises a first air supplement pipeline 41 and a first air supplement fan 42. One end of the first air supplement pipeline 41 is connected with the air outlet of the preheating section 1, the other end of the first air supplement pipeline 41 is in communication with the air inlet of the first air supplement fan 42, and the air outlet of the first air supplement fan 42 is in communication with the mixing chamber 43. In operation, the first air supplement fan 42 operates, and the air in the preheating section 1 enters the mixing chamber 43 through the first air supplement pipeline 41 and the first air supplement fan 42, so that the structure is simple and reliable.
[0031] Further, in the embodiment, the first air supplement pipeline 41 is provided with a first filter 44. The first filter 44 is used to filter the air outlet of the preheating section 1, so as to avoid impurities in the air outlet from entering the mixing chamber 43 and then entering the preheating section 1 and the high-temperature section 2, which is beneficial to ensure the cleanliness of the air supplement of the preheating section 1 and the high-temperature section 2.
[0032] Further, in the embodiment, the first air supplement pipeline 41 is further provided with a first surface cooler 45. The first surface cooler 45 is used to cool and dehumidify the air outlet of the preheating section 1, so as to reduce the influence of the air supplement on the temperature and humidity of the air in the preheating section 1 and the high-temperature section 2, which is beneficial to keep the oven stable.
[0033] As a preferred embodiment, the first air supplement pipeline 41 is arranged on the side surface of the preheating section 1, and the mixing chamber 43 is arranged on the top surface of the preheating section 1. The hot air entering the preheating section 1 from the high-temperature section 2 has a tendency to flow upward. Arranging the mixing chamber 43 on the top surface of the preheating section 1 is beneficial to collect the air outlet of the preheating section 1, and also facilitates the smooth entry of the mixed air into the preheating section 1 and the high-temperature section 2, and does not change the existing structure of the preheating section 1, so that the structure is simple and reasonable.
[0034] Further, in the embodiment, the second air supplement assembly 5 comprises a second air supplement pipeline 51 and a second air supplement fan 52. One end of the second air supplement pipeline 51 is in communication with the second air outlet 432, the other end of the second air supplement pipeline 51 is connected with the air inlet of the second air supplement fan 52, and the air outlet of the second air supplement fan 52 is connected with the air inlet of the high-temperature section 2. In operation, the second air supplement fan 52 operates, and the air in the mixing chamber 43 enters the high-temperature section 2 in sequence through the second air outlet 432, the second air supplement pipeline 51 and the second air supplement fan 52, so that the structure is simple and reliable.
[0035] As a preferred embodiment, the second air supplement pipeline 51 and the second air supplement fan 52 are arranged on the top surface of the high-temperature section 2, which is beneficial to the smooth entry of the mixed air in the mixing chamber 43 into the high-temperature section 2, and does not change the existing structure of the high-temperature section 2, so that the layout is simple and reasonable.
[0036] Further, in the embodiment, the third air supplement assembly 6 comprises a third air supplement fan 61 and a third air supplement pipeline 62, the air inlet of the third air supplement fan 61 is communicated with the air outlet of the cooling section 3, the air outlet of the third air supplement fan 61 is communicated with one end of the third air supplement pipeline 62, and the other end of the third air supplement pipeline 62 is communicated with the mixing chamber 43. In operation, the third air supplement fan 61, the air in the cooling section 3 enters the mixing chamber 43 through the third air supplement fan 61 and the third air supplement pipeline 62, and the structure is simple and reliable.
[0037] Further, in the embodiment, the cooling section 3 is provided with a second surface cooler 31, and the third air supplement pipeline 62 is provided with a second filter 63. The second surface cooler 31 is used to cool and dehumidify the exhaust air of the cooling section 3, so as to reduce the influence of the air supplement on the temperature and humidity of the air in the preheating section 1 and the high-temperature section 2, and facilitate the stable operation of the oven; the second filter 63 is used to filter the exhaust air of the cooling section 3, so as to avoid that impurities in the exhaust air enter the mixing chamber 43 and then enter the preheating section 1 and the high-temperature section 2, and facilitate the cleanliness of the air supplement of the preheating section 1 and the high-temperature section 2.
[0038] As a preferred embodiment, the third air supplement fan 61 is arranged on the top surface of the cooling section 3, and the third air supplement pipeline 62 is arranged on the top surfaces of the cooling section 3 and the high-temperature section 2, so as to facilitate the smooth entry of the exhaust air of the cooling section 3 into the mixing chamber 43, and meanwhile, the existing structure of the cooling section 3 is not changed. Of course, in other embodiments, the third air supplement pipeline 62 can be directly connected with the first air supplement pipeline 41 to mix, and then the preheating section 1 and the high-temperature section 2 are supplemented with air, but compared with the special mixing chamber 43, the mixing effect is slightly poor.
